Solid State Hybrid Drives (SSHDs) combine the best of both worlds in terms of storage technology. These innovative drives utilize a combination of traditional hard disk drives (HDDs) and solid-state drives (SSDs) to provide a high-performance storage solution. With larger storage capacities and faster data access speeds compared to traditional HDDs, SSHDs offer an excellent balance between affordability and performance. These drives intelligently store frequently accessed data on the faster SSD portion, while less frequently used data is stored on the HDD section. This unique hybrid design ensures improved overall system performance, making SSHDs a popular choice for those seeking enhanced storage capabilities.

Seagate Momentus XT 500 GB 2.5 Inch Solid State Hybrid Drive ST95005620AS

The Seagate Momentus XT is a 2.5 inch solid state hybrid drive that combines the performance of a solid state drive (SSD) with the storage capacity of a traditional hard drive. With its Adaptive Memory technology, it customizes performance to align with user needs, resulting in an overall improved system response. The drive stores the most accessed data on its 4 GB SLC SSD, delivering SSD-like performance while offering ample storage space. In PCMark Vantage benchmark scores, it outperforms traditional 7200-RPM drives by 80 percent. Not only does it provide faster performance, but it also operates quietly with low heat and vibration, making it an ideal choice for those who prioritize a quiet computing experience. Factors to Consider when Choosing a Solid State Hybrid Drive

Storage Capacity

When selecting a solid state hybrid drive (SSHD), consider the storage capacity that meets your needs. Look for an SSHD with ample space to store your files, documents, games, and multimedia content. Consider both your current and future storage requirements to ensure you have enough space for your data.

Speed and Performance

SSHDs combine the speed of a solid state drive (SSD) with the larger storage capacity of a traditional hard disk drive (HDD). Look for an SSHD with a high rotational speed (RPM) for improved performance. The SSD portion of the drive should provide fast boot times, quick file access, and smooth multitasking.

Cache Size

The cache size is an important factor to consider in SSHDs. The larger the cache size, the more data the drive can store temporarily, resulting in faster access times. Look for an SSHD with a sizable cache to enhance overall performance.

Reliability and Durability

Ensure the SSHD you choose is reliable and durable. Look for drives from reputable manufacturers with a good track record for quality and longevity. Consider features like shock resistance and power loss protection to safeguard your data against accidents or power outages.

Compatibility

Confirm that the SSHD is compatible with your system. Check the interface (such as SATA or NVMe) and the physical dimensions (2.5-inch or M.2) to ensure a proper fit in your computer or laptop. Additionally, check for compatibility with your operating system for seamless integration.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What are the pros and cons of solid-state hybrid drives?

Solid State Hybrid Drives (SSHDs) offer a balance between traditional HDDs and full SSDs. They provide faster performance and more storage space at a more affordable price. However, they have limitations, including a shorter lifespan, reliability issues, and slower speeds compared to full SSDs.

2. Is hybrid drive better than SSD?

While SSDs are the most power-efficient option, solid-state hybrid drives (SSHDs) come in a close second. SSHDs frequently spin down like HDDs, minimizing power consumption. However, the impact on battery life in a laptop is generally not significant, typically less than 10%.

3. What are the advantages of solid-state hybrid drive over hard disk drive?

Solid-state hybrid drives (SSHDs) offer several advantages over traditional hard disk drives (HDDs). These include higher durability and reliability, faster speeds, power and energy efficiency, lighter weight, and quieter operation. Additionally, they come in more practical sizes and form factors.

4. Is hybrid SSD worth it?

Hybrid drives, also known as solid-state hybrid drives (SSHDs), provide a cost-effective solution for fast performance and increased storage capacity. However, they may not match the speed and performance of full SSDs. In enterprise storage systems, all-flash SSDs are more commonly used for primary data storage.

5. Are SSHD still used?

SSHDs are still used because they offer a more affordable way to enhance both speed and capacity in computers. While standalone SSDs provide faster speeds, they can be expensive for larger capacities. HDDs are cheaper in terms of capacity, but they lack the speed offered by NAND flash storage in SSHDs.

6. Do solid state drives last longer than HDD?

Yes, solid-state drives (SSDs) generally have a longer lifespan compared to hard disk drives (HDDs). HDDs typically last around 3-5 years, while SSDs can last up to 10 years or more. This is because SSDs have no moving parts, which reduces the risk of mechanical failure over time.
